Recruiter
Nick Kyriazidis
Recruiter
Nick Kyriazidis
Location
Athens
|
Salary
2500€ - 3000€
|
Contract type
Permanent
|
Industry
|
About the role
On behalf of our client, a leading innovative product development company located in Athens, we are currently looking for a highly skilled enthusiastic and motivated senior .Net developer to join their Digital team in its fascinating projects and growing team.
A day in the life of a ‘.Net Developer’
You will have acquired extensive knowledge in .net web development either as a Mid or Senior level Engineer and you will be present to the full development lifecycle. You will design, modify, develop, write and implement software components for various applications and portals.
Your day to day
- Design, modify, develop, write and implement software and components for web applications Intranet apps/Agent web clients / portals /services /CMS applications, owned by the company
- Work from written specifications to provide production version of the applications through internal software development/ testing processes
- Utilize established development tools, guidelines and conventions including Visual Studio, ASP.NET, Web Application Development, NET MVC 4/5, WCF, RESTful, Web API, SQL Server, HTML, CSS, JavaScript, jQuery, AngularJS, and C# .NET
- Using TFS (team foundation server) for version control of the code and team development process
- Deliver work products that meets specifications, are defect free, and have optimal performance
What you will need
- BSc in Computer Sciences or any other relevant degree
- Minimum 2+ years development experience
- Web development experience using C#, ASP.NET, MVC
- Experience in Design patterns, O/R mapping (Entity Framework ,LINQ, Nhibernate)
- Experience with Web Services, SOA
Great to have
- Experience in JavaScript, JSON, HTML, CSS, XSLT, AJAX, jQuery, SQL, MS Visual Studio IDE, TFS code versioning
- Experience in developing and deploying load balanced high traffic webs
- Microsoft developer certifications (i.e. MCPD, MCSD)
- Task management tools experience (attlasian Jira)
We love your personality if you
- Down to earth
- Accountable
- Aspirated
- Team player
What’s in it for you
A competitive salary along with the opportunity to work among a dynamic and technically advanced team. You will collaborate with top-notch clients and become part of a great team with various projects. Additionally, the company offers excellent career prospects.